SC upholds Bombay HC ruling; underscores preferential right of landowner to redevelop slum | Mumbai News

MUMBAI: In yet another order that shot down acquisition by the Maharashtra government and Slum Rehabilitation Authority of an upscale private property in Mumbai, the Supreme Court on Friday upheld a Bombay high court judgment that said law provides preferential right to the landlord to redevelop the slum area.
